The Brainwavz BLU 200 wireless Bluetooth earphones are successor to Blu 100 wireless headphone and comes with bigger driver size. They feature a stylish matt black aluminum body with an in-line remote for added convenience.  With a range of 30ft (10m), you can comfortably be away from your audio source with no disruption to audio quality or performance. And if you want that extra security, a pair of ear hooks is included to ensure your BlU-200 are an absolute secure fit. The right ear tip is equipped with micro-USB port for charging the earphone and is covered by a rubber flap. Embedded within the housing is a micro 60mAh battery that delivers up to 4 hours of continuous audio playback, 100 hours of standby and can be fully charged in under 2 hours.

Brainwavz BLU200

The Blu 200 resembles a thin flat cable that goes behind your neck with earbuds on each end and an inline microphone/remote in between.  In the box is also included 3 pairs of Silicon ear tips of varying sizes to pick the right size for your ear and to derive the best sound experience. The ear buds does not fall off while on the move and are securely fit in the ears.

The three button remote is used raise volume up and down, and play/pause in located in center. The play/pause button doubles as the answer/end call button. A full review of the manual will outline the other functions, including how to fast forward, rewind, skip tracks, and use voice commands for your phone or computer.

What is aptX and how does it work?

Advertisment

As wireless earphone with Bluetooth audio are becoming  becomes more and more popular, you may now find “aptX” appearing on more products. aptX is also an compression algorithm like mp3, only difference being that mp3 uses psychoacoustic modeling to take out data, wherein aptX uses time domain ADPCM. Digging deeper aptX uses fewer bits per sample and reduces the required bandwidth for a given signal-to-noise ratio making files smaller while retaining quality.

aptX technology must be incorporated in both transmitter and receiver to derive the sonic benefits of aptX audio coding over the default sub-band coding (SBC).

To review the performance we paired the Blu-200 with iPhone 5S and it was easily recognized by it. Two devices can be paired with the speaker simultaneously, allowing you and a friend to switch between music on your respective devices without having to re-pair each time. The headphone also maintained the healthy connection between the range of 10 giving you the freedom to to move around, no more long cables or tangles.

On tracks with intense sub-bass content, like DJ Magic Mike’s “Feel The Bass,” the headphone pumped out appreciable amount of oomph and detail and sounded much better than Blu 100 due to extra driver size. The mid and treble ranges are well-defined, and surprisingly, the vocals sound crisp and clear, even at low volume levels.

On tracks like Titanium by David Guetta which features dance club style beats, the speaker produced high fidelity sound with attacking bass and oomph, and sounded booming and bright making this melody truly pleasurable from starting to end. Sia’s vocals were clearly audible in between the bass of this electric pop song. Even when you are listening to orchestral tracks it sounds clear, with higher register strings, bass, and vocals maintaining their presence in the spotlight.

The microphone worked well with calls and we faced no drop out during testing. Your listening experience will be enhanced if you have an aptX compatible device.
